Visual C++ Kreator modelu
Visual C++ Kreatora Model zapewnia obsługę automatyzacji kreatorów projektowanie i dostarcza metod następujących zagadnień rozwoju kreatora:
Uruchamianie kreatorów opartych na interfejsie użytkownika i nie opartych na interfejsie użytkownika.
Modyfikowanie zawartości w interfejsie użytkownika HTML kreatora.
Obsługa nawigacji dla strony kreatora.
Kontrolowanie interakcji użytkownika z interfejsu użytkownika w formacie HTML.
Uzyskiwanie dostępu do Visual C++ kod modelu dla kwerend, sprawdzanie poprawności danych wejściowych użytkownika i generowania kodu.
Podczas badania informacji o bibliotece typu.
Obsługa błędów i raportowania błędów.
Visual C++ Modelu Kreator udostępnia również metod pomocniczych, które są używane przez kreatorów, wyposażone w Visual C++.
Następujące obiekty są zdefiniowane w Visual C++ modelu kreatora.
Obiekt |
Opis |
---|---|
IVCWizCtlobiekt. |
Coclass dla IVCWizCtlUI i IVCWizCtl interfejsów, zawierające metody i właściwości, które kontrolują kreatora niestandardowy formant HTML. |
VsWizardobiekt. |
"Coclass", który implementuje IDTWizard.Execute metody. |
WizComboobiekt. |
Coclass dla IWizCombo zawierające metody, właściwości i zdarzeń, sterujące niestandardowych Kreator pól kombi. |
IEnumInfoobiekt. |
Zawiera informacje dotyczące projektu kreatora wyliczenie członków. |
IFuncInfoobiekt. |
Zawiera informacje na temat funkcji projektu kreatora. |
IInterfaceInfoobiekt. |
Zawiera informacje o interfejsach projektu kreatora. |
IParamInfoobiekt. |
Zawiera informacje o projekcie Kreatora funkcji i zmiennych parametrów. |
ITypeLibInfoobiekt. |
Zawiera informacje dotyczące projektu kreatora biblioteki typów. |
IVarInfoobiekt. |
Zawiera informacje o zmiennych projektu kreatora. |
Więcej informacji na temat niestandardowych Visual C++ kreatorów, zobacz Tworzenie kreatora niestandardowych.
Zobacz też
Zadania
Jak: interpretować Visual C++ Kreator modelu przykłady